Johnny M. Ball was born in Sallisaw Oklahoma, he departed from this earth on August 21st 2021 at the age of 72 at St. Vincent's Hospital in Little Rock, Arkansas. He was 1967 graduate of Trumann, Arkansas and John Brown University. Johnny worked as a Real Estate Broker for over 40 years with Cooper Land Developers. He was preceded in death by his mother, Beatrice Hester; sister, Janice Honeycutt; maternal grandparents, Jessie and Mary Perry.
He is survived by his daughter, Amy Ball and grandson Mark Perry, both of Hot Springs; three brothers and a sister, Butch (Janis) Strange of Henderson, Arkansas, David (Jean) Craig of Brookland, Arkansas, Michael (Debbie) Craig of Jonesboro, Arkansas and Kathy (Bob) Jackson also of Jonesboro.
Johnny was gifted in the aspect of telling jokes and playing pranks, he loved to be the life of the party and to make you laugh, he enjoyed life. His hobbies included golf, snow skiing, hunting and fishing. He lived life from top to bottom and has no regrets. He was a member of the Hope Lutheran Church in Heber Springs.
